When placing Cheesy beef and bean burrito and Ramona’s Burritos Potato and Beef side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
Cheesy beef and bean burrito is the more energy-dense option here, packing 40 more calories per 100g than Ramona’s Burritos Potato and Beef.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
In terms of sugar control, Cheesy beef and bean burrito takes the lead with only 0.877g of sugar per 100g, whereas Ramona’s Burritos Potato and Beef contains 3.52g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
Looking to build muscle? Cheesy beef and bean burrito offers a protein boost with 9.65g per 100g, outperforming Ramona’s Burritos Potato and Beef in this category.
